728x90
Confluence는 요구사항 및 테스트 스펙 문서를 작성 시 아주 편리해요
이때, Requirement yogi라는 요구사항 관리 plugin을 주로 사용하죠
이 Plugin의 장점은 traceability 인데
최상위 ~ 최하단 요구사항, Test case와 Test 대상의 traceability를 확인 할 수 있다
사용 하면서 느낀 Requirement yogi의 핵심 컨셉을 정리해봐요
Requirement Yogi 핵심 매크로
크게 2가지 매크로를 사용해요

✔️ Requirement Yogi definition
- 새로운 Requirement key 정의
✔️ Requirement Yogi link
- 이미 정의 된 Requirement key 링크
Requirement Yogi 사용 법
1열은 Requirement Yogi definition 위치
2열은 Description
3열부터 Requirement Yogi link 위치
NOTE
각 열의 속성은 Requirement Yogi Configuration 매크로로 변경 가능해요
System Requirement → Arch Requirement → Unit Requirement 예시로 살펴보면
아래와 같은 형태가 됨

UNIT.001을 클릭해보면 아래와 같이 Traceability 확인 가능

Dependency graph 상 연결 된 ARCH.001을 눌러보면 아래의 Traceability 확인 가능

Dependency graph 상 연결 된 SYS.001 눌러보면 아래의 Traceability 확인 가능

이렇게 하나씩 타고 올라가면 최 상단 요구사항까지 도달할 수 있어요
Takeaway
Requirement Yogi를 통해 간결하게 요구사항 key 관리 및 traceability 확보 가능
728x90
'TIL > 2025' 카테고리의 다른 글
| MCP가 무엇인지? (1) | 2025.12.21 |
|---|---|
| [Error] Your branch and 'origin/feature-1' have diverged (0) | 2025.12.10 |
| Hash와 Digital Signature (0) | 2025.12.09 |
| Confluence 문서 상태 관리 feat. Comala (0) | 2025.11.07 |
| [cpp] type_traits (0) | 2025.09.24 |